Core Insights - The current wave of new e-commerce is reshaping the global business landscape, with cross-border e-commerce playing a crucial role in driving digital economic development and linking global consumers [1][4] - The fifth China New E-commerce Conference highlighted the importance of e-commerce in injecting new momentum into economic growth, particularly in regions like Yanbian, which exemplifies the robust development of China's cross-border e-commerce [1][2] Group 1: Cross-Border E-commerce Growth - Yanbian, located at the geographical center of Northeast Asia, has seen its cross-border e-commerce import and export volume grow by over 30% year-on-year in 2024 [2] - The latest report indicates that the cross-border e-commerce trade volume in Jilin Province through customs management platforms is 5.4 times that of 2021, with a year-on-year growth of 68.3% in the first half of this year [3] - China's cross-border e-commerce import and export volume is expected to surge by 10.8% year-on-year in 2024, accounting for 6% of total foreign trade, with a tenfold increase in scale over the past five years [4] Group 2: Industry Challenges and Responses - The global trade landscape is undergoing significant adjustments, with cross-border e-commerce facing unprecedented challenges, including the withdrawal of tax exemption policies and increased regulatory responsibilities for platforms [5][6] - Experts suggest that companies should promote the internationalization of China's regulatory code system and establish localized compliance teams to navigate the varying requirements across different regions [5] - The cancellation of small package tax exemptions in the U.S. poses a significant challenge for companies relying on low-cost small package models, necessitating a strategic focus on maintaining stability in the European and American markets [5][6] Group 3: Technological Advancements - Technological advancements, particularly in AI, are injecting vitality into new e-commerce, enhancing platform operations, supply chain optimization, and risk control [7] - AI technologies are being utilized to improve customer service efficiency and enhance transaction conversion rates, demonstrating their role as a foundational infrastructure for rebuilding trust in cross-border trade [7]
